Skilled Youth Backbone of Aatmanirbhar Bharat, Says UP CM Yogi at World Youth Skills Day Celebration

CM presents ‘Youth Icon’ awards, flags off ‘Skill Chariots’, and unveils major MoU with MNNIT to boost skill ecosystem in Uttar Pradesh

Lucknow: Uttar Pradesh Chief Minister Yogi Adityanath on Tuesday reiterated that skilled youth are the backbone of a self-reliant India, and emphasized the government’s firm commitment to empowering them through training, technology, and employment. Speaking at the World Youth Skills Day celebrations held at Indira Gandhi Pratishthan, Lucknow, the CM inaugurated a two-day Skill Fair and Exhibition showcasing the talents of young trainees from all 75 districts of the state.

Themed “Youth Empowerment through AI and Digital Skills”, the event highlighted the importance of equipping India’s youth with future-ready tools such as artificial intelligence, robotics, drone tech, and digital literacy, alongside traditional trades.

UP, with over 56% of its 25 crore population in the working age group, is full of potential. By aligning our youth’s talent with the needs of the market, we are creating the foundation for a self-reliant India,” said CM Yogi.

Tech-Driven Empowerment & Skilling Initiatives

CM Yogi underscored the government’s efforts to digitally empower the youth:

  • Distribution of 2 crore smartphones and tablets to students; 50 lakh already distributed
  • 150 government ITIs upgraded in partnership with Tata Technologies
  • Approximately 400 govt and 3,000 private ITIs operational in the state
  • Scholarships and incentives provided for students in private institutes

He also stressed that UP’s improving law and order, coupled with investor-friendly policies, has attracted ₹15 lakh crore in investments over the past 8 years, generating lakhs of new jobs.

Support for Traditional Skills

The CM spotlighted two flagship schemes:

  • One District One Product (ODOP): Over 1.5 crore people have gained employment
  • Mukhyamantri Vishwakarma Shram Samman Yojana: More than 1 lakh artisans trained and equipped with toolkits

These schemes have revived traditional industries and brought dignity and income to craftsmen and artisans, strengthening the rural economy,” he added.

Honouring Talent and Industry

As part of the event, CM Yogi:

  • Presented the ‘Youth Icon’ Award to 15 outstanding youths
  • Handed over appointment letters to 11 candidates
  • Flagged off 5 Skill Chariots to promote skilling awareness across the state
  • Honoured select industry leaders with the ‘Industry Ambassador’ Award
  • Witnessed the signing of an MoU with Motilal Nehru National Institute of Technology (MNNIT), Prayagraj, appointing it as a knowledge partner to enhance skilling outcomes
